Gaia:Images are powerful weapons of resistance and catalysts of experience that allow us to work about our past-present. Starting from the problematization of historical representation, in this proposal we link images and images of the visual arts with historiography, crossing and intertwining the specialties in order to generate new reflections and knowledge in their communicating vessels. Methodologically we work in the inter and transdisciplinary, through thinking with images leads us to walk between their visual ties.To articulate our proposal, we take as case studies diverse fragments of the history and symbolic-visual, cultural-identity images of Chile –linked to the “homeland” and ancestral origin– for from its confluences, as well as possible epistemic resistances, revising, constructing and de-constructing the official narratives with the ultimate aim of contributing to the articulation of methodologies for rewriting stories.
